    CODE OF CONDUCT AND ETHICS

     

     

    PURPOSE

     

    The public purpose and tax exempt status of charitable organizations includes an obligation to maintain the public trustthe. Love Through Education International

    (LTEI) has always taken this responsibility very seriously and strives to set an example for the field of philanthropy in all of its activities. Accordingly, it is incumbent upon volunteers of LTEI to conduct the affairs of LTEI with a commitment to the highest standards of integrity. This includes acting at all times in an honest and ethical manner, in compliance with all laws and regulations and avoiding actual, potential or apparent conflicts of interest. Compliance with this Code of Conduct and Ethics will sustain a culture where honest and ethical conduct is recognized, valued and exemplified throughout LTEI.

     

    PROVISIONS

     

    1. Conflicts of Interest Generally

     

    Volunteers of LTEI have a full-time responsibility to the Organization. A potential or actual conflict of interest occurs whenever a volunteer is in a position to influence a decision that may result in a personal gain for him or herself, any other volunteer or an immediate family member. (For the purposes of this policy “immediate family” means a volunteer’s spouse or domestic partner, parents, siblings, children and in-laws.) A volunteer may not engage in activities that create a conflict between the interests of ESI and those of the volunteer. In certain circumstances, the Organization may also be concerned about the appearance of a conflict of interest, even if no actual conflict has occurred.

     

    2. Gifts and Other Payments

     

    Except for gifts of nominal value or meals and social invitations that are in keeping with good business ethics and do not obligate the recipient, volunteers or members of their immediate families or domestic partners may not accept commissions, gifts, payments, entertainment, services, loans, or promises of future benefits from any person or entity relating to his or her LTEI assignment.

    3. Relationships to Suppliers

     

    Volunteers with responsibility for issuing or approving orders for the purchase of supplies, equipment, or transportation, or for contracts for employment or services for the Organization, may not have a significant interest in any supplier of supplies or services to the Organization. Nor may the volunteer’s immediate family have such an interest. (“Significant interest” means any financial interest that may influence the judgment of the volunteer in conducting the work of the Foundation.)

     

     

    4. Service on Boards

     

    LTEI volunteers who are invited to serve in their individual capacities as directors may accept such invitations only with the prior approval in writing of the President. Factors to be considered in evaluating such invitations include:

    a) Conflict of interest issues;

    b) Likelihood of time conflicts: whether the affiliation or assignment interfere with the individual’s ability to carry out his or her Organization responsibilities;

    c) Whether there is a strong relationship to the Director’s job at the Organization or professional training;

    d) What professional benefits are likely to flow to the individual and to the Organization; and

    e) Whether there is a possibility that the other organization may misperceive the relationship as enhancing the chance of ESI funding.

     

     

    5. Speaking Engagements and Articles for Publication

     

    a) Volunteers are encouraged to maintain their professional credentials by undertaking speaking engagements and writing articles appropriate to their fields of interest. Possible speeches or articles should be discussed with the appropriate Directors.

    b) In writing or speaking in an individual capacity, volunteers are expected to clearly so indicate. Whether or not it is appropriate to explicitly disclose the volunteer’s association with the Organization depends on the circumstances. If in doubt, the volunteer should consult the President or any Director of the Board...

     

     

    6. Political Activities

     

    Volunteers are free to engage in political activities when, in the volunteers’ judgment, such activities will not conflict with their ability to carry out Organization responsibilities. Volunteers should keep in mind, when making such decisions, the potential difficulty in outside perception in distinguishing between the volunteers personal and professional capacities. No political activities can be conducted with the use of any Organization resources.

    7. Confidentiality - Disclosure of Information

     

    Volunteers are expected to exercise the utmost discretion in regard to all matters of Organization business. They may not communicate any information known to them by reason of their position that has not been made public, except as may be necessary in the course of their duties or by authorization of the President. Nor shall they at any time use such information to private advantage. These obligations are not modified by participation in any activities described above and do not cease upon separation from the Organization.

     

    8. Compliance with Laws and Regulations

     

    A variety of laws and regulations apply to the Organization, the violation of which may carry civil or criminal penalties for the Organization and/or the individual. It is the responsibility of each volunteer to comply with all such laws and regulations. Volunteers are also required to observe the laws and regulations of countries in which they travel, including each country’s currency exchange regulations.

     

    9. Accuracy of Financial Accounting and Reporting

     

    The Organization takes very seriously its obligation to comply with the highest standards of financial accounting and reporting. Volunteers, in addition to complying with all applicable laws, rules and regulations, to the extent applicable to their duties must:

    a) Endeavor to ensure full, fair, timely, accurate and understandable disclosure in the

    Organization’s filings;

    b) Record or participate in the recording of entries in the Organization’s books and records that are accurate to the best of their knowledge;

    c) Comply with the Organization’s disclosure controls and procedures and internal controls and procedures for financial reporting; and

    d) Provide information that is accurate, complete, objective, relevant, timely and understandable.

     

    PROCEDURES FOR COMPLIANCE WITH THIS CODE

     

    1. Reporting Requirements and Procedures

     

    A volunteer must promptly disclose actual or potential conflicts of interest to the appropriate director. When invited by an outside group for a speaking engagement or media interview which requires approval, the volunteer should write a memo to the Board requesting approval. The memo should set forth the details, including the amount of time that will be required; the benefit to the Organization, the possible cost to the Organization, and the relationship of the group to the Organization.

     

    A volunteer must promptly disclose all gifts and other payment received and any relationships with suppliers to the appropriate Director.

     

    2. Complaint Procedure

     

    If a volunteer thinks he or she has, or in good faith thinks another volunteer has, violated any provision of this Code, that volunteer should immediately report the suspected violation to the President and appropriate Directors within the Organization. Reported violations of this Code will be investigated, addressed promptly and treated confidentially consistent with the need to investigate, prevent or correct the violation.

     

    3. Retaliation is Prohibited

     

    No one reporting an actual or suspected violation of this Code or other unlawful act in good faith will be subject to retaliation of any kind. Retaliation against an individual for reporting an actual or suspected violation of this Code in good faith or for participating in an investigation of a violation is a serious violation of this Code and may be subject to disciplinary action.

     

     

    4. Law Suit is Prohibited

     

    No director or member of any category of the organization is allowed to sue each other as individuals or as a group against the other group, committee of the organization or the Board of the organization unless it is a criminal case. Any non-criminal disputes, charges and complaints must be resolved in the General Meeting. The decision made in the General Meeting is final.
